Title Ballad of a Child
Production Date c. 1962
Country of Production Czechoslovakia
Duration 00:09:47
Film Subject Era 1939-1945
Genre Drama
Summary A reconstruction of true events, this short drama follows an expectant mother's journey to the hospital. As she goes into labour, she recollects the events of the Second World War and how she was taken from her family in Lidice to be raised by a new family.
